Web13 jul. 2024 · ADARs catalyze site-specific RNA editing in short imperfect RNA duplexes, whereas hyperediting that involves many adenosines occurs in long perfect RNA duplexes. Majority of ADAR-mediated RNA editing events in long duplex RNAs occurs in the 3′-UTR and 5′-UTR of mRNAs and in introns, especially in the context of Alu sequences.
